How Mountain State College Compares
$8,665 annual tuition places Mountain State College in the mid-to-upper range for trade colleges, where typical in-state pricing runs $3,000–$10,000. Net price after grants and scholarships averages $16,395. For WV students, this is mid-pack on cost — worth checking aid coverage carefully.

What Are the Student Loan Numbers at Mountain State College? (2023-24)
95% of undergraduates at Mountain State College borrow federal student loans, with an average loan of $7,784. Understanding repayment options early is important.
